Enter an equation in point-slope form for the line. Slope is 4 and (−3, −1) is on the line. The equation of the line in point sl
Licemer1 [7]

Answer:

y + 1 = 4 (x + 3)

Step-by-step explanation:

The formula is y - y1 = m (x - x1), so you put the variables in to y1 and x1 plus add the slope in as m, and there you are! Point slope form.
